解决pyttsx3无法封装的问题


Posted in Python onDecember 24, 2018

一、python3下面的pyttsx3正常可以使用,类似下面:

import pyttsx3
engine = pyttsx3.init()
rate = engine.getProperty('rate')
engine.setProperty('rate', rate-60)
engine.say('123')
engine.runAndWait()

二、但是一旦用pyinstaller封装成exe后,运行就会提示

1. pyttsx3.drivers模块找不到

解决pyttsx3无法封装的问题

2. 在dreiver.py(pyttsx3的配置文件)加上from pyttsx3.drivers import sapi5 依然会提醒错误。

三、细看win下面调用的drivers模块为sapi5, 里面依然是封装了win32com.client.Dispatch('SAPI.SPVoice')这个模块,可以直接用win32com.client自己改写封装就好,不用pyttsx3模块。

以上这篇解决pyttsx3无法封装的问题就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
python实现去除下载电影和电视剧文件名中的多余字符的方法
Sep 23 Python
Django发送html邮件的方法
May 26 Python
Python下实现的RSA加密/解密及签名/验证功能示例
Jul 17 Python
python实现黑客字幕雨效果
Jun 21 Python
python3利用venv配置虚拟环境及过程中的小问题小结
Aug 01 Python
利用Pandas和Numpy按时间戳将数据以Groupby方式分组
Jul 22 Python
pandas和spark dataframe互相转换实例详解
Feb 18 Python
浅谈python的elementtree模块处理中文注意事项
Mar 06 Python
tensorflow从ckpt和从.pb文件读取变量的值方式
May 26 Python
基于tensorflow for循环 while循环案例
Jun 30 Python
Python中Yield的基本用法
Oct 18 Python
python 使用tkinter与messagebox写界面和弹窗
Mar 20 Python
pyttsx3实现中文文字转语音的方法
Dec 24 #Python
python实现flappy bird游戏
Dec 24 #Python
Python爬虫实现获取动态gif格式搞笑图片的方法示例
Dec 24 #Python
python 在屏幕上逐字显示一行字的实例
Dec 24 #Python
python之Flask实现简单登录功能的示例代码
Dec 24 #Python
python实现逐个读取txt字符并修改
Dec 24 #Python
Python判断一个list中是否包含另一个list全部元素的方法分析
Dec 24 #Python
You might like
用PHP连mysql和oracle数据库性能比较
2006/10/09 PHP
开启CURL扩展,让服务器支持PHP curl函数(远程采集)
2011/03/19 PHP
如何解决CI框架的Disallowed Key Characters错误提示
2013/07/05 PHP
PHP微信企业号开发之回调模式开启与用法示例
2017/11/25 PHP
thinkphp5框架前后端分离项目实现分页功能的方法分析
2019/10/08 PHP
在laravel框架中使用model层的方法
2019/10/08 PHP
JS 对象介绍
2010/01/20 Javascript
JQuery 获得绝对,相对位置的坐标方法
2010/02/09 Javascript
jQuery实现在最后一个元素之前插入新元素的方法
2015/07/18 Javascript
基于JavaScript实现点击页面任何位置返回
2016/08/31 Javascript
jQuery移除或禁用html元素点击事件常用方法小结
2017/02/10 Javascript
详解使用grunt完成requirejs的合并压缩和js文件的版本控制
2017/03/02 Javascript
微信小程序 登录的简单实现
2017/04/19 Javascript
详解用node-images 打造简易图片服务器
2017/05/08 Javascript
详解vue-cli 接口代理配置
2017/12/13 Javascript
layui点击左侧导航栏,实现不刷新整个页面,只刷新局部的方法
2019/09/25 Javascript
vue自定义正在加载动画的例子
2019/11/14 Javascript
Vue中使用Lodop插件实现打印功能的简单方法
2019/12/19 Javascript
jQuery实现放大镜案例
2020/10/19 jQuery
vue.js+element 默认提示中英文操作
2020/11/11 Javascript
Python判断直线和矩形是否相交的方法
2015/07/14 Python
python画蝴蝶曲线图的实例
2019/11/21 Python
Django中的session用法详解
2020/03/09 Python
Python 测试框架unittest和pytest的优劣
2020/09/26 Python
详解使用canvas保存网页为pdf文件支持跨域
2018/11/23 HTML / CSS
用Python匹配HTML tag的时候,<.*>和<.*?>有什么区别
2012/11/04 面试题
中科前程Java笔试题
2016/11/20 面试题
成考报名单位证明范本
2014/01/16 职场文书
承认错误的检讨书
2014/01/30 职场文书
党员学习党的群众路线思想汇报(5篇)
2014/09/10 职场文书
挂职个人工作总结
2015/03/05 职场文书
个人年终总结结尾
2015/03/06 职场文书
2015年母亲节寄语
2015/03/23 职场文书
CSS 实现Chrome标签栏的技巧
2021/08/04 HTML / CSS
Spark SQL 2.4.8 操作 Dataframe的两种方式
2021/10/16 SQL Server
Java+swing实现抖音上的表白程序详解
2022/06/25 Java/Android